Heath McAdams ID’d as Teen Killed in Pedestrian Crash on U.S. Highway 83 near Anthony Harbor in Broaddus

Broaddus, Texas (September 9, 2022) – The San Augustine County Sheriff’s Office has identified the teen who died following a pedestrian accident early Sunday morning in Broaddus as Heath McAdams, 18, of Lufkin.

The deadly crash happened just after 2:00 a.m. Sunday, September 4, just off U.S. Highway 83 near Anthony Harbor.

First responders found McAdams just off U.S. Highway 83.

McAdams died in the crash.

This crash remains under investigation. Additional information is not available at this time.
